London: Printed for A. Strahan; and T. Cadell in the Strand, 1789. First edition. vii, [i], 437, [1] pp.; [ii], 389, [1]pp. 2 vols. 8vo. Bound in contemporary tree calf, spines neatly laid down. First edition. vii, [i], 437, [1] pp.; [ii], 389, [1]pp. 2 vols. 8vo. Account of the newlywed Mrs. Piozzi's tour of the continent with her husband. Her "first work not to fall under the long shadow of Johnson, she built upon previous experimentation by using an authoritative but conversational discourse, alive with present-tense immediacy, to erode the barriers between diary and travel narrative. Her delight in Piozzi and in Italy was everywhere apparent in the materials she included in this development of the genre, which subverted masculine tropes of the grand tourist as disillusioned and hard to please" (ODNB). Her descriptions of Italy were a source for Ann Radcliffe's MYSTERIES OF UDOLPHO. Rothschild 1551
